Stuck on '/dev/sda1: clean, 427878/7331840 files, 10391195/29304832 blocks'. That /dev/sda1: clean line indicates that the fsck has been completed successfully. If that's the last message on boot, the problem has almost certainly nothing to do ... WebDec 4, 2016 · 26.
